    • POSSIBLE DUPLICATION
      This person is PROBABLY, but unsubstantiated, the same person as listed brother JUAN GERMAN. Ages would aligned, Juan is not found in 1790 Census, and no other record for Francisco can be found.

    2. [S162] CENSUS 1790 - Alta California, (sfgenealogy.com/sf/ca1790.htm).
      1790 CENSUS - SANTA BARBARA
      Isidro German, espanol, from Villa Sinaloa, 36; wife Manuela de Ochoa, mestiza, [from Villa Sinaloa] 30; five children: Francisco, 9; Maria Antonia, 5; Maria Gertrudis, 5; Maria Dionisia, 3*; {Juana Feliciana, 2*}; Cristobal Antonio, 2 {should be 1 or less, born 3 June 1790}.
      *Note Maria Dionisia and Juana Feliciana are the same person. Her names vary between the two in many mission records.
